UK Beer Sales Down

UK beer sales dipped sharply in the second quarter 2012, as poor weather, and the impact of another substantial tax hike in the March Budget failed to compensate for strong trading around the Jubilee weekend and the Euro 2012 football. These new sales figures come from the British Beer & Pub Association quarterly Beer Barometer, issued today.

The British Beer & Pub Association also says that the six per cent decline in sales means the tax hike has brought the Chancellor no extra revenues. Its Chief Executive, Brigid Simmonds, has called recent claims from Minister Chloe Smith that, the policy was helping to tackle the deficit, “misguided”. UK beer sales have fallen by 15 per cent since the controversial policy was introduced in March 2008, with beer duty up by an eye-watering 42 per cent over the same period. The BBPA and Oxford Economics believe this decision will cost some 5,000 jobs in 2012/13.

Alcohol Calorie Content Questionnaire.

Most Brits overestimate the number of calories in beer, with women more likely to do so than men, according to new research by ComRes on behalf of the British Beer & Pub Association.

The survey found that one in five people (19 per cent) correctly estimated the calorie content of beer – fewer than for wine, where a quarter (25 per cent) get it right. However when questioned, women are significantly more likely to overestimate the calorie content of drinks (wine, beer, orange juice).

The survey found that around half (53-5 per cent) of respondents did not know the number of calories in a range of popular drinks. In fact you may be surprised to learn that beer is less calorific than wine:
• A half pint (284ml) of 2.8% ABV bitter (80 calories)
• A half pint (284ml) of 4% ABV lager (96 calories)
• A 175ml glass of 12.5% red wine (119 calories)
• A 175ml glass of 12.5% white wine (131 calories)

Inflation and Interest Rate Levels a Cause for Optimism for Homeowners

The average mortgage debt level is significantly higher today than in 1990 when it stood at £35,000 compared to £120,400 today. Property repossessions are also higher than they were 22 years ago (43,900 compared to £36,200), while the unemployment rate stands at 8.4 per cent opposed to 6.9 per cent.

But it is not as bad as it sounds; Peter Dockar, head of mortgages at HSBC said: "The evidence suggests in many ways we are now better off than in the last downturn of the early 1990s.

“Inflation is half what it was then while the bank rate is a thirtieth lower, meaning borrowing is far more affordable.

"It is unlikely we will ever see rates peak as high as they did in 1990 in our lifetimes, however, there is no doubt that rates can only go one way from their historic low in future so it is essential that borrowers are prepared financially for future fluctuations in the cost of borrowing."

Halifax Mortgage Rate Increase

Halifax, the UK's biggest mortgage lender will raise it's SVR from the May 1st from 3.50 per cent to 3.99 per cent.Halifax said it had made this decision because of the higher cost of raising funds for mortgages from both savers and the financial markets.

The increase will add about £300 a year to mortgage payments for someone with a £100,000 mortgage.

Last week RBS said that it would raise its SVR rates from 3.75 per cent to four per cent on three of its mortgage products.

A spokesman from the Halifax said: "The change acknowledges that the cost of funding a mortgage in today's market remains significantly higher than the longer term average.".

Halifax says that customers who wish to transfer their SVR balance to a new Halifax product or a different lender will not incur an early repayment charge.

London's Investments For the Future

Batteresea is finally going to have its place on the Tube Map.The Northern Line Extension (NLE) will improve transport capacity throughout the Vauxhall Nine Elms area with stops at Wandsworth Road and Battersea Power Station. It will also relieve pressure at Vauxhall station.

In November 2011 the extension was included in a group of infrastructure projects announced by George Osborne, due to be backed by the Government,although completed with private sector funding.

In the proposal Battersea Power Station would become the focus for a new town centre with 66,000 square metres of retail, restaurant and cafe space - more than Clapham Junction and Wandsworth town centres.

London Olympic Effect is Not an Issue for London Property Lettings or Sales

Property owners who are expecting to reap the benefits of increased rental returns during this year's big London events should not set their sights too high. The Olympics and Jubilee celebrations have not really prompted a mass surge of enquiries for short term lets;it appears that 90 percent of letting enquiries about this period are speculative enquiries coming from would be landlords planning to leave London during these busy events,and make a quick killing at the same time.

The Olympic or Jubilee Effect has also been used to promote the sale of London investment and buy to let property at overseas property shows. Recent surveys show that there has been a marked increase in Australian investment in residential buy to let property. However,this is more likely to be the result of the strong Australian dollar and familiarity with the London rental market, than with a one off events.

Any other recent rise in overseas nationals increased interest and purchase can be directly traced back to events in the home country; Russians seeking a safe haven in the run up to unnerving presidential elections; Cash rich Greeks are also seeking a steady investment during uncertain economic times; Chinese investors have already replaced those from Russia and the Middle East as the busiest property investors, led by their Government looking to invest huge, surplus to requirements, sovereign wealth fund.
